Differences in Inpatient Alcohol and Drug Rehab in Millheim, Pennsylvania

Today, different inpatient alcohol and drug rehabilitation centers vary regarding the outline and execution of their addiction rehab offerings and services. For example, the duration of time you will spend undergoing therapy and detoxification will vary from one center to another. Whereas some programs last as long as nine months or longer, others may be more brief and take about 30 days.

In the same way, these centers in Millheim vary regarding the level of autonomy and freedom clients have while participating in drug and alcohol addiction rehab. Some of the facilities are locked down, where clients won't be able to leave the facility as you battle your drug and alcohol abuse and any co-occurring mental health disorders. In such a center, you may not even be have access to the internet or be allowed visitors. Other facilities, however, may allow you some leeway to associate with the world outside while still remaining focused on total recovery.

When you choose inpatient drug and alcohol treatment, therefore, it is imperative that you look into different centers and choose the one that best suits your needs. Some of the factors you should consider include:

a) Monetary Policies

Ask the residential facility whether they accept insurance, offer financial support, and have a number of payment choices.

b) Offerings and Services

You should also research and find out what the Millheim, PA. treatment program has to offer in terms of accommodation, food, recreation, therapy, and other formats of drug and alcohol addiction rehab.

As you continue looking into different inpatient drug treatment centers, keep in mind that no given program will be effective for every addict. To this end, it might be in your best interests to carefully determine what every center can offer until you get to a facility that is best suited to meet your needs and preferences.

Overall, inpatient drug rehab is among the most workable of all types of drug and alcohol addiction rehabilitation protocols. The time spent in one of these programs will ensure that you can productively focus on your treatment free from the temptations and triggers that you might come across if you choose outpatient rehab.
